Eligibility

Inclusion criteria

Inclusion criteria: Tobacco Chewers belonging to the following 3 Groups Group 1 - Individuals with histopathologically confirmed Oral Squamous Cell Carcinoma (not previously treated for the condition) , n=37 Group 2 - Individuals with histopathologically confirmed Oral Leukoplakia and not previously treated for the condition , n=37 Group 3 - Apparently Healthy , Age and Sex matched individuals with normal Oral Mucosa , n=37

Exclusion criteria

Exclusion criteria: Non - Tobacco chewers Individuals with secondary Oral Cancer or any other Systemic Conditions Individuals unable to provide adequate Saliva sample
